Pulled this from the rack as the capsule looked a bit swollen from a bit of leakage, but if it had been leaking, it had stopped, and the there was no mould on top of the cork. The cork itself was damp and crumbly throughout, and took a bit of a struggle to extract it in as few pieces as possible. My homemade Durand imitation (i.e. using a long threaded corkscrew and a butler's thief in conjunction) got it out though. The colour is on the deeper side of mid gold. Clearly riesling on the nose, and mature riesling at that. Barley sugar, bruised windfall sweet apples, and a little smokiness. On the palate, it's pretty much as you would expect from the nose: mature riesling, feeling slightly sweet initially, but the sweetness is allayed by the acidity that's still clinging on. Remarkably little raisining on the palate. Just feels a little hollow and not int eh best condition.
